The first patch was rejected back then because H.264 support in the V4L2 API 
had to be implemented differently. Recent discussions about H.264 and V4L2 
resulted in a different position, so I can now apply the patch. I've asked 
Stephan for his Signed-off-by line and I will push it to v3.2.

I still need to review the second patch properly, that's on my TODO list.
